The helmet is stainless steel (16 guage I believe), and has a stainless steel chainmail aventail which extends about (22cm) 9in from the bottom ridge of the helmet with padding underneath as well as inside the helmet. The entire helmet including the mail and padding are in great shape. It also has brass embelishing along the edges of the visor. I think it's probably a size medium to large because it's a bit loose on me and I don't have a very small head. The helmet dose have a small opening between the visor and aventail when closed. The helmet is about 29cm (11.5in) tall, about 34cm (13.5in) visor tip to back, and about 19cm (7.5in) wide internally from ear to ear.
